Alexander Emmanuel Rodriguez is one of the most recognized figures in baseball history. Born on July 27, 1975, in New York, USA, he demonstrated exceptional sporting ability from a young age. Throughout his illustrious career, Rodriguez earned numerous awards for his elite-level play on the field. His career path remains a source of inspiration for fans around the world.
Growing up in Miami, Florida, Rodriguez quickly emerged as a standout athlete. At the prestigious Westminster Christian School, he dominated on the baseball field. Scouts were impressed by his natural abilities, and he soon became a highly sought-after prospect.
In 1993, Rodriguez was drafted first overall by a Major League Baseball franchise by the Seattle Mariners organization. This milestone marked the beginning of a remarkable rise to stardom. Joining the Mariners allowed him to develop his skills at the highest level.
Rodriguez made his professional debut at the highest level in 1994. Although he was one of the youngest players in the league, he demonstrated maturity beyond his years. His all-around skill set quickly made him a fan favorite.
The 1996 season proved to be a turning point in his career. Rodriguez established himself among baseball's best players. His ability to contribute in multiple areas made him a cornerstone player for Seattle.
As his reputation reached new heights, Rodriguez became known for his remarkable work ethic. Coaches and teammates often admired his professionalism. These qualities helped him achieve sustained success.
In the 2001 season, Rodriguez signed a record-breaking contract with the Texas Rangers. The contract made headlines across the sports world. While expectations were extremely high, Rodriguez continued to deliver strong performances.
During his time with the Rangers, Rodriguez continued to strengthen his reputation. He received numerous accolades and proved his value on the field.
A major chapter of his career began when he joined the New York Yankees. Playing for the Yankees brought new opportunities. Rodriguez embraced the challenge and became a key contributor.

The memorable 2009 year stands as one of the highlights of Rodriguez's career. He played a crucial role in helping the Yankees win the MLB championship. His postseason performances were highly influential to the team's success.
Despite his achievements, Rodriguez's career also included challenges. Discussions surrounding performance-enhancing substances became a significant part of the public conversation. Nevertheless, his on-field accomplishments and impact on baseball continue to be subjects of extensive debate and analysis.
Following his retirement, Rodriguez successfully transitioned into entrepreneurship. He became a sports commentator and expanded his interests into various industries. His post-playing career has demonstrated his versatility.
Beyond baseball, Rodriguez has participated in charitable efforts. He has supported educational causes and various organizations aimed at helping others. These activities reflect his desire to give back to the community.
